Chapter 18: Problem 11
Describe two operations that all queues perform.
Chapter 18: Problem 11
Describe two operations that all queues perform.
All the tools & learning materials you need for study success - in one app.
Get started for freeT F A static stack or queue is built around an array.
Suppose the following operations are performed on an empty stack: push(8); push(7); pop(); push(19); push(21); pop(); Insert numbers in the following diagram to show what will be stored in the static stack after the operations above have executed.
Write two different code segments that may be used to wrap an index back around to the beginning of an array when it moves past the end of the array. Use an if/else statement in one segment and modular arithmetic in the other.
Suppose the following operations are performed on an empty stack: push(8); push(7); pop(); push(19); push(21); pop(); Insert numbers in the following diagram to show what will be stored in the static stack after the operations above have executed.
Suppose the following operations are performed on an empty queue: enqueue(5); enqueue(7); dequeue(); enqueue(9); enqueue(12); dequeue(); enqueue(10); Insert numbers in the following diagram to show what will be stored in the static stack after the operations above have executed.
What do you think about this solution?
We value your feedback to improve our textbook solutions.